Recipe of the Month: Baked Potato Soup

Aultman is back to share another cold weather recipe to warm you up! Enjoy a filling and hearty comfort food in a healthy way! Check out the easy recipe below.

BAKED POTATO SOUP

Ingredients:

• 2 russet potatoes, washed and dried
• 1 small head of cauliflower, stem removed cut into florets
• 1 ½ cups fat-free chicken broth
• 1 ½ cups 1% reduced-fat milk
• Salt and freshly cracked black pepper
• ½ cup light sour cream
• 10 tablespoons reduced-fat shredded sharp cheddar cheese
• 6 tablespoons chopped chives, divided
• 3 slices bacon, cooked and crumbled

Directions:

1. Pierce potatoes with a fork; microwave on high for 5 minutes, turn over and microwave another 3-5 minutes, until tender. Or if you prefer to use your oven, bake at 400 degrees for 1 hour or until tender. Cool and peel potatoes
2. Meanwhile, steam cauliflower with water in a large covered pot until tender. Drain and return to pot.
3. On medium heat, add chicken broth, milk, potatoes, and bring to a boil. Use an immersion blender to puree until smooth.
4. Add sour cream, half the chives, salt and pepper and cook on low another 5-10 minutes, stirring occasionally.
5. Remove from heat. Ladle 1 cup soup into each bowl top each serving with 2 tablespoons cheese, remaining chives and bacon.


Nutrition Information:

Yield: 5 servings, Serving Size: 1 cup, Calories: 200, Fat: 7 g, Carbohydrates: 23 g, Cholesterol: 17mg, Sodium: 323 mg, Fiber: 3.5 g, Protein: 14 g, Exchanges:  1 starch, 1 meat, 1 fat, 1 vegetable,
